Daughter of Solomon Badman and Emily Cox. Survivor the sinking of the Titanic in 1912. Emily married in 1913 to Michael O'Grady. They had four children: Thomas, Michael, John and Margaret. Titanic Survivor. She was a third class passenger on the RMS Titanic. She boarded the ship in Southampton, England on April 10th. She was rescued from collapaseable lifeboat "C" by the Carpathia and arrived in New York City on April 18, 1912. The following week she served as a bridesmaid for fellow Titanic survivor Sarah Roth.
